The San Francisco 49ers represents the biggest pivot point in the NFL’s 2021 Draft after its deal with the Miami Dolphins, which caused shock waves in the league.

Now choosing the third overall place in the first round after sending the 12th choice and two future debuts to Miami, the Niners are ready to land the defender of the future.

General manager John Lynch and coach Kyle Shanahan are under significant pressure to ensure that they make the right choice that will determine the direction of the franchise in the next decade.

With Trevor Lawrence and Zach Wilson expected to leave the board with choices one and two, it is a three horse race between Justin Fields, Trey Lance and Mac Jones to become the successor to Jimmy Garoppolo.

San Francisco has no glaring holes after the free agency and can therefore use the rest of the project to build on its strengths and resolve any small weaknesses with its eight remaining choices after the first round.

Adding depth to the cornerback and edge rusher is likely to be the focus of Niners, while they may also be looking to increase their options on the offensive line on the wide receiver. All of these areas are covered in this latest simulation sketch for San Francisco.
